The new analyser is hailed as ’a next generation spectrometer that sets the standard for the rapid analysis of all common elements in metals’. The Spectromaxx is ’faster, more precise, offers increased flexibility and requires less maintenance’ than predecessors, the company states. The spectrometer analyses nitrogen levels in steel down to a level of 20ppm. An Argon Saver Mode is claimed to reduce argon costs by 40 to 60% depending on sample throughput. ICAL, Spectro’s patented intelligent calibration logic, is also fitted as standard to monitor system integrity and eliminate the need for recalibration samples. The Spectromaxx also features expanded element selection and calibration ranges, as well as a unique readout system which shaves seconds off analysis time. The Spectromaxx is available as either a bench-top or floor unit to cater for flexible work-flow and space requirements. It offers fast access to service/maintenance points and is designed for comfortable operation at high sample throughput rates.
